TPWalletETH 币的技术架构与发展策略解析

概述:

TPWalletETH 币(以下简称 TP 币)作为一个以太坊生态内的代币与钱包服务组合,应同时兼顾链上合约安全、链下数据存储与用户体验。本文从分布式存储、ERC223 标准、防止中间人攻击、先进技术应用、合约权限设计及发展策略六个维度做系统性说明,给出实现与落地的技术建议。

一、分布式存储的角色与选择:

1) 角色:用于存储非交易性大数据(如 NFT 大体量媒体、用户偏好、钱包备份碎片、审计日志等),减轻链上成本并提高抗审查性。2) 选择:优先采用 IPFS + Filecoin 或 Arweave 混合方案:IPFS 负责去中心化内容寻址与缓存,Filecoin 提供长期存储保障,Arweave 可做永久存储选项。3) 安全与验证:所有链下数据应保存内容哈希并写入链上(或元数据合约),通过哈希校验避免篡改。数据加密(对称或属性基加密)用于保护私有用户数据;公开元数据可直接公开存储。

二、为什么采用 ERC223 及其实现要点:

1) 背景:ERC20 在将代币发送到合约地址时存在丢失风险(合约未实现接收逻辑)。ERC223 在 transfer 过程中调用接收方的 tokenFallback(或类似回调),避免“误送”代币丢失。2) 实现要点:实现 ERC223 时需兼容主流钱包和交易所、提供回退逻辑,同时保留 ERC20 接口兼容层(双接口),并写良好的接收合约调用失败回退策略。3) 安全提示:回调中不可执行危险外部调用,防止重入;推荐使用 Checks-Effects-Interactions 模式并配合重入锁。

三、防止中间人(MITM)攻击的工程实践:

1) 前端与后端通道:强制使用 HTTPS/TLS 并启用 HSTS 与证书透明度;对关键域名实施证书锁定或证书钉扎。2) 签名与消息格式:采用 EIP-712(结构化数据签名)保证签名内容不可被篡改或重放,使用域分离(domainSeparator)防止跨合约重放。3) 钱包与密钥管理:推广硬件钱包或使用多方安全计算(MPC)、门限签名减少私钥被盗风险;对敏感操作交由多签确认(如 Gnosis Safe)。4) 中继与链下服务:中继节点应验证签名并签署时间戳/nonce,采用防重放机制与可验证日志。5) 用户体验:在 UI 明显展示签名请求详情(收款地址、数据摘要、有效期),并提供可验证交易摘要预览。

四、先进技术在 TP 生态的应用场景:

1) Layer2 与扩容:通过 Optimistic Rollups 或 ZK-Rollups 降低手续费与提高吞吐,主网保留结算安全性。2) ZK 技术:用于隐私交易、可验证计算或证明用户某种资格(如 KYC 证明而不泄露详情)。3) MPC 与阈值签名:对托管、社群托管和合约升级相关授权进行门限控制,降低单点私钥风险。4) Oracles 与预言机:使用去中心化预言机(Chainlink 等)为合约提供可信外部数据。5) 可组合性:使 TP 币支持 DeFi、借贷、流动性挖矿与跨链桥接,利用跨链协议(如 Axelar、Hop)实现互操作。

五、合约权限与治理设计:

1) 最小化权限原则:合约应默认无管理员或管理员权限受限,仅在必要时授予。2) 权限模型:采用多层权限(Owner、Admin、Minter、Pauser 等)与角色化访问控制(OpenZeppelin AccessControl),并对关键操作要求多签与 timelock(治理延迟)以便审计与回滚窗口。3) 可升级性:审慎使用代理模式(Transparent 或 UUPS),并把升级权限交由去中心化治理或受时间锁保护的多签集体控制。4) 应急机制:实现 pause/unpause 功能、紧急提取受限路径与事后审计日志;同时确保任何应急功能本身也受多签/延时限制。

六、发展策略(Roadmap 与市场策略):

1) 技术路线分阶段:测试期(内部测试与闭测)-> 测试网公开测试(白帽奖励)-> 主网首发(限制性释放)-> Layer2 部署与跨链互操作。2) 安全优先:在每一阶段执行第三方安全审计、持续模糊测试(fuzzing)与形式化验证(对关键模块)。3) 社区与激励:设计清晰代币经济(锁仓、流动性激励、治理激励),启动社区大使计划、流动性矿池与空投对早期用户。4) 合作与合规:与交易所、钱包(尤其硬件钱包与Gnosis Safe)建立集成;遵守当地法律与 KYC/AML 要求,必要时提供合规通道。5) 开发者生态:发布 SDK、合约示例、开发文档与测试网 faucet,举办黑客松促进生态建设。

结语与检查清单:

- 在设计中将分布式存储哈希与链上元数据绑定;

- ERC223 与 ERC20 兼容,避免代币丢失;

- 使用 EIP-712、证书钉扎与硬件钱包降低 MITM 风险;

- 引入 ZK、MPC、Layer2 等前沿技术逐步扩展能力;

- 合约权限使用角色化、多签与时间锁以保障去中心化与安全;

- 制定阶段化发展策略、重视审计与社区参与。

通过上述技术与治理组合,TPWalletETH 币可在保证安全性与可扩展性的前提下,逐步构建可信、可用并富有竞争力的生态。

作者:晨曦Tech发布时间:2026-02-14 21:26:29

评论

Alex

内容很全面,尤其是对 ERC223 与分布式存储的实操建议,受益匪浅。

小米

关于 MITM 的那部分写得很细,EIP-712 确实是关键。

CryptoFan88

建议补充一下具体审计厂商和工具链(比如 Slither、MythX)以便落地。

李白

发展策略务实,可读性强,点赞。希望能看到实际路线图时间点。

相关阅读
<del lang="k875sl"></del>